Problems solved by technology

Oftentimes, the lists of goals and adjustable experimental parameters are long and diverse, and it may not be clear how to incorporate or prioritize all the different combinations to be tried.
Moreover, these techniques insufficiently handle high-dimensional problems with many experimental parameters.
This approach eschews statistical modeling in favor of experimenter intuition and results in a haphazardly selected set of experiments that may not adequately test enough variations of parameters.

Embodiment Construction

[0015]The figures and the following description relate to preferred embodiments by way of illustration only. It should be noted that from the following discussion, alternative embodiments of the structures and methods disclosed herein will be readily recognized as viable alternatives that may be employed without departing from the principles of what is claimed.

[0016]A preferred embodiment includes a multi-component software system with which an experimenter interacts. FIG. 1 outlines the steps of one example of a development testing process that a development team might use. Information about the development task is entered 110. This may include a definition of the development task, such as the experiment parameters that may be varied, the outcome variables and the desired goals or specifications. Abstract

Recommendations for new experiments are generated via a pipeline that includes a predictive model and a preference procedure. In one example, a definition of a development task includes experiment parameters that may be varied, the outcomes of interest and the desired goals or specifications. Existing experimental data is used by machine learning algorithms to train a predictive model. The software system generates candidate experiments and uses the trained predictive model to predict the outcomes of the candidate experiments based on their parameters. A merit function (referred to as a preference function) is calculated for the candidate experiments. The preference function is a function of the experiment parameters and / or the predicted outcomes. It may also be a function of features that are derived from these quantities. The candidate experiments are ranked based on the preference function.
